Documents Required –
- Passport copy (with 6 months validity)
- UAE Visa copy (with 6 months validity)
- Emirates ID Copy (front & back page)
- One passport sized Digital photo with white background
Visa Types –
- Single entry – Stay period – 30 Days, Validity - 3 Months
- Double entry – Stay period – 30 Days per visit, Validity - 3 Months
- Multiple entry – Stay period – 30 Days per visit, Validity - 3 Months
Processing time – 4 - 5 days from the time of submission.
